Latest Patents

Yukio Iwabuchi holds a patent for a controlling apparatus that features a display and operating unit connected to a main unit with the ability to be separated. In this design, when the connection with the main unit is separated, the display and operating unit can be attached to the front surface of a panel. The connector cable is routed through an opening on the panel, with packing positioned to enclose the periphery of the opening. This allows the display and operating unit to be securely attached to the front surface, while the main unit is fixed to the back surface. The connector at the end of the cable engages with the main unit's connector, establishing a connection between the two components.
